Lot Description

A late 19th century gold micro mosaic brooch, depicting a Cherub.

Diameter 2.9cms. 11.1gms.

Varied scratches and small marks. Small acid mark to reverse.
General slight dirt and debris.
Later safety chain, slight soft solder at join.
Electronically tests as approximately 9ct gold.
Fellows uses a Thermo Scientific Nitron Handheld XRF Analyser to test metals. This technology is limited to examining metal to a depth of approximately 8 microns.
Fellows does not guarantee the standard of gold or platinum unless an item is hallmarked. Results from electronically tested items should only be used as a guide and with caution, as false readings are possible.
